Nilpesh Patel, MD, is a board-certified orthopaedic surgeon at Orthopaedic Specialists of Dallas, located in Rockwall, Wylie, Forney, and Terrell, Texas. Dr. Patel specializes in hand, wrist, and elbow surgery, including sports-related injuries, fracture treatment of the upper extremity, Dupuytren's contracture, and traumatic and nerve-related conditions.
A North Carolina native, Dr. Patel graduated from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ill in 2000 with a political science and chemistry degree. He continued his education at the University of North Carolina, receiving his medical degree in 2004.
Dr. Patel moved to Atlanta, Georgia, and completed a five-year residency in orthopaedic surgery at Emory University. With an interest in hand and upper extremity surgery, he moved across the country for specialized training at the University of Washington in Seattle, where he completed the prestigious fellowship in hand and microvascular surgery.

Dr. Venkat Sethuraman is a board-certified orthopedic surgeon, fellowship trained in spine surgery at the Mayo Clinic in Rochester, Minnesota. He has done more than 1,000 spine surgeries over his 20 years in practice in the Dallas area.
Unlike other spine surgeons who often spend 30% of their time on brain disorders or treatment of knees and hips, Dr. Sethuraman focuses 100% on the care of back and neck pain and other complex spine problems.
Dr. Sethuraman is proficient in minimally invasive spine surgery techniques enabling outpatient surgery through a half-inch incision. He stays current on the newest advances in spine surgery and non-surgical treatment options. He is referred patients from across the Dallas area and its suburbs, as well as patients who travel from Mexico for advanced spine care.
Dr. Sethuraman completed a fellowship in spine surgery at the renowned Mayo Clinic in Rochester, Minnesota. A fellowship is the most advanced and specialized physician training available.
He received his Bachelor of Science degree in 1994 at Rutgers University graduating magna cum laude. He earned his medical degree at the Medical College of Pennsylvania in 1998. He completed an internship in General Surgery at Thomas Jefferson University Hospital along with his residency in Orthopaedic Surgery. Following his residency, he went to the world famous Mayo Clinic in Rochester, Minnesota, where he completed a spine surgery fellowship. Dr. Sethuraman is a member of the American Academy of Orthopedic Surgeons, the North American Spine Society, and the Mayo Clinic Alumni Association.
Recognizing the challenges of developing a freestanding spine center and a modern medical practice, in 2017 Dr. Sethuraman completed a Masters in Business Administration (MBA) from the prestigious Wharton School at University of Pennsylvania.
